##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 4.19:1 — AA fail,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#9e49ee (4.52:1); AA: background → #0f0f0f (4.57:1); AAA: text → #7b14db (7.08:1)
- On black (#000000): 5.01: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AAA: text → #ba7cf3 (7.27:1)
